[Alpha Biz=(Chicago) Reporter Kim Jisun] The shutdown of the redevelopment project in Daejo District 1, the largest fish for redevelopment in Eunpyeong-gu, Seoul, has begun.

According to the construction industry on the 21st, Hyundai Engineering & Construction sent an official letter later in the day that it would suspend construction from Jan. 1 next year if it did not pay construction costs to the Daejo District 1 union.

Hyundai Engineering & Construction is expected to withdraw all its personnel and equipment from the redevelopment site and start exercising its lien.

The Daejo District 1 redevelopment project is a project to redevelop 112,000 square meters of land in Daejo-dong, Eunpyeong-gu, Seoul, to build 2,451 apartments (Hillstate Mediale) in 28 buildings and 25 stories above the ground.

The current progress rate is around 22%. The construction of the complex began in October last year. However, the organization has virtually collapsed due to internal strife in the union, including the suspension of duties as the union leader. As a result, we could not proceed with the sale that was planned for the first half of this year.

As a result, Hyundai Engineering & Construction has not received about 180 billion won in total construction costs since its construction began in October last year.

Hyundai Engineering & Construction is known to have informed the union that construction could be suspended if construction costs are not paid from the first half of this year.

However, the situation has not improved due to the absence of a union leader, and the union has yet to set a time for the sale. Eventually, the construction was stopped.
